Bone health tends to get attention after a fracture, but it's worth thinking about long before that point. Bone density peaks in early adulthood and gradually decreases over time, a process influenced by activity level, nutrition, hormonal changes, and other health factors.

When bone density decreases significantly, the risk of fracture increases, particularly in the hip, spine, and wrist. The elbow is a remarkably stable joint, but that stability comes with complexity. It relies on a coordinated system of bones, ligaments, tendons, and muscles to support the full range of arm movement, from bending and straightening to rotating the forearm.

Elbow concerns vary widely, from acute injuries like fractures and dislocations to gradual conditions like lateral epicondylitis, medial epicondylitis, and olecranon bursitis. Because the elbow is involved in so many upper extremity tasks, even mild dysfunction can meaningfully affect daily function and activity.

Joint sounds typically occur when tendons shift slightly over a joint or when small gas bubbles release within the joint fluid. Neither process causes arthritis.

What is worth paying attention to is joint sounds that come with pain, swelling, stiffness, or changes in range of motion. Those combinations may indicate something that warrants a closer look.

Ankle sprains are among the most common musculoskeletal injuries, and one of the most frequently undertreated. Because many sprains allow some degree of weight-bearing, it's easy to assume they'll resolve on their own. In some cases, they do, but more significant ligament injuries that don't receive appropriate care can lead to chronic instability and a higher likelihood of re-injury.

Whether it's a long road trip, a cross-country flight, or a full day at a desk, extended sitting places more stress on the lumbar spine than most people realize. The discs absorb increased pressure, the surrounding muscles fatigue, and over time, those cumulative effects can contribute to stiffness, discomfort, and longer-term concerns.
